1 Div Inter-Brigade Turney Opens In Kaduna

1 Division Nigerian Army yearly sporting event, Inter- Brigade Sports Competition scheduled to hold from 23-27 September, 2019 opened on Monday.
The tournament currently ongoing at the Nigerian Defence Academy (NDA) Sports Complex, Ribadu Cantonment, Kaduna is an annual event amongst formations under 1 Division Nigerian Army.
The participants were drawn from 3 Brigade, Kano, 31 Artillery Brigade, Minna and 1 Division Garrison, Kaduna.
Declaring the tournament open, General Officer Commanding (GOC), 1 Div, Major General Faruq Yahaya reminded the participants of the need to embrace the spirit of sportsmanship where a winner must emerge and not see it as do it die affair.
The GOC said, “the competition is aimed at selecting sports men and women that will represent the Division in the forthcoming Nigerian Army Sports Festival.
“This year’s division inter-brigade sports championship is yet another opportunity for the brigades under the command to slog it out in 19 sporting events.
“This should improve your spirit of team work and build your endurance. This is also part of the efforts by the current Army leadership to have a responsible and responsive troops for the protection of Nigerian territorial integrity.
“On the whole, it is expected that, the championship would bring forth new talents, new sportsmen and women who would represent the Division, the NA and the Country at international sporting events.”
Earlier, the Garrison Commander, 1 Div, Brigadier General Jimmy Akpor said, the event was designed to enable troops developing their sporting skills to brighten the division’s chances to the national excellence in global sporting championships.
About 900 athletes and officers are expected to participate in the competition which features football, athletics, judo, swimming, basket ball, lawn tennis, boxing, tug of war, cross country/half marathon, chess, scrabble, volleyball, taekwondo, badminton etc.
